Using the biological species definition, yeasts of the genus Saccharomyces sensu stricto comprise six species and one natural hybrid. Previous work has shown that reproductive isolation between the species is due primarily to sequence divergence acted upon by the mismatch repair system and not due to major gene differences or chromosomal rearrangements. The reproductive strategies of Cichlids: Hemichromis fasciatus, Oreochromis niloticus, Sarotherodon galilaeus and Tilapia zillii was studied from June, 2007 to December, 2008. The variability in egg –size (i.e. diameter) were measured using the micrometer eye-piece in a binocular microscope.
